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Edit track of a problem - Story 4.2 #297

Open
husseny opened this issue Apr 21, 2014 · 1 comment
Open

Edit track of a problem - Story 4.2 #297

husseny opened this issue Apr 21, 2014 · 1 comment

Comments

@husseny
Copy link
Collaborator

husseny commented Apr 21, 2014

As a Lecturer/TA, I should be able to edit the track of the problem

  • Drop down list view in the edit page
  • Change the track in the database
  • Refreshing the track name with Ajax
  • Handing failure demo when the track has a problem with the same title
  • documentation of methods

Success Demos

  • Choose a course from ""Courses"" list in the homepage of the TA.
  • A list will appear containing all the topics included in the course chosen.
  • Choose a certain topic
  • The tracks of the topic will appear.
  • Click on a certain track.
  • A List of all the problems added to the track will appear. Beside each problem there will be a button 'edit'
  • Click on edit will the edit problem page will appear
  • Click on edit track and a drop down list of the tracks of the topic and the current track highlighted

Failure Demos

  • The chosen track has a problem of the same title: the TA is notified that a problem with a similar title will already exist
  • No changes has been made because the TA chose the same track of the problem: The TA is notified snd given the option to continue without saving or returning
@husseny husseny added this to the Sprint 1 milestone Apr 21, 2014
@husseny husseny self-assigned this Apr 21, 2014
husseny pushed a commit that referenced this issue Apr 22, 2014
…sing ajax to refresh flash notice and track name
husseny pushed a commit that referenced this issue Apr 22,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
@mohamedfadel
Copy link
Collaborator

Doc. verified.

hus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
…ying to update the problem with the same track, title or description
husseny pushed a commit that referenced this issue Apr 24, 2014
husseny pushed a commit that referenced this issue Apr 24, 2014
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ants